Home
last modified time | relevance | path

Searched refs:iec (Results 1 – 19 of 19) sorted by relevance

/freebsd/contrib/bearssl/src/ssl/
H A Dssl_scert_single_ec.c89 r = pc->iec->mul(data, *len, pc->sk->x, pc->sk->xlen, pc->sk->curve); in se_do_keyx()
90 xoff = pc->iec->xoff(pc->sk->curve, &xlen); in se_do_keyx()
114 return pc->iecdsa(pc->iec, hc, hv, pc->sk, data); in se_do_sign()
130 const br_ec_impl *iec, br_ecdsa_sign iecdsa) in br_ssl_server_set_single_ec() argument
139 cc->chain_handler.single_ec.iec = iec; in br_ssl_server_set_single_ec()
H A Dssl_ccert_single_ec.c99 r = zc->iec->mul(data, *len, zc->sk->x, zc->sk->xlen, zc->sk->curve); in cc_do_keyx()
100 xoff = zc->iec->xoff(zc->sk->curve, &xlen); in cc_do_keyx()
123 return zc->iecdsa(zc->iec, hc, hv, zc->sk, data); in cc_do_sign()
144 const br_ec_impl *iec, br_ecdsa_sign iecdsa) in br_ssl_client_set_single_ec() argument
153 cc->client_auth.single_ec.iec = iec; in br_ssl_client_set_single_ec()
H A Dssl_hs_client.c245 if (!ctx->eng.iecdsa(ctx->eng.iec, hv, hv_len, &pk->key.ec, in verify_SKE_sig()
286 if ((ctx->eng.iec->supported_curves & ((uint32_t)1 << curve)) == 0) { in make_pms_ecdh()
296 order = ctx->eng.iec->order(curve, &olen); in make_pms_ecdh()
309 ctx->eng.iec->generator(curve, &glen); in make_pms_ecdh()
315 if (!ctx->eng.iec->mul(point, glen, key, olen, curve)) { in make_pms_ecdh()
322 xoff = ctx->eng.iec->xoff(curve, &xlen); in make_pms_ecdh()
325 ctx->eng.iec->mulgen(point, key, olen, curve); in make_pms_ecdh()
1600 uint32_t x = ENG->iec == NULL ? 0 : ENG->iec->supported_curves; in br_ssl_hs_client_run()
H A Dssl_hs_server.c272 if (!((ctx->eng.iec->supported_curves >> curve) & 1)) { in do_ecdhe_part1()
285 order = ctx->eng.iec->order(curve, &olen); in do_ecdhe_part1()
298 glen = ctx->eng.iec->mulgen(ctx->eng.ecdhe_point, in do_ecdhe_part1()
345 ctl = ctx->eng.iec->mul(cpoint, cpoint_len, in do_ecdhe_part2()
347 xoff = ctx->eng.iec->xoff(curve, &xlen); in do_ecdhe_part2()
436 if (!ctx->eng.iecdsa(ctx->eng.iec, in verify_CV_sig()
1667 uint32_t x = ENG->iec == NULL ? 0 : ENG->iec->supported_curves; in br_ssl_hs_server_run()
H A Dssl_hs_client.t0190 if (!ctx->eng.iecdsa(ctx->eng.iec, hv, hv_len, &pk->key.ec,
231 if ((ctx->eng.iec->supported_curves & ((uint32_t)1 << curve)) == 0) {
241 order = ctx->eng.iec->order(curve, &olen);
254 ctx->eng.iec->generator(curve, &glen);
260 if (!ctx->eng.iec->mul(point, glen, key, olen, curve)) {
267 xoff = ctx->eng.iec->xoff(curve, &xlen);
270 ctx->eng.iec->mulgen(point, key, olen, curve);
H A Dssl_hs_server.t0217 if (!((ctx->eng.iec->supported_curves >> curve) & 1)) {
230 order = ctx->eng.iec->order(curve, &olen);
243 glen = ctx->eng.iec->mulgen(ctx->eng.ecdhe_point,
290 ctl = ctx->eng.iec->mul(cpoint, cpoint_len,
292 xoff = ctx->eng.iec->xoff(curve, &xlen);
381 if (!ctx->eng.iecdsa(ctx->eng.iec,
H A Dssl_hs_common.t0236 uint32_t x = ENG->iec == NULL ? 0 : ENG->iec->supported_curves;
/freebsd/bin/dd/
H A Dmisc.c107 char iec[4 + 1 + 3 + 1]; /* 123 <space> <suffix> NUL */ in progress() local
115 humanize_number(iec, sizeof(iec), (int64_t)st.bytes, "B", HN_AUTOSCALE, in progress()
120 (uintmax_t)st.bytes, si, iec, secs, persec); in progress()
/freebsd/contrib/bearssl/inc/
H A Dbearssl_x509.h783 const br_ec_impl *iec; member
875 const br_ec_impl *iec, br_ecdsa_vrfy iecdsa) in br_x509_minimal_set_ecdsa() argument
878 ctx->iec = iec; in br_x509_minimal_set_ecdsa()
H A Dbearssl_ssl.h1115 const br_ec_impl *iec; member
1663 br_ssl_engine_set_ec(br_ssl_engine_context *cc, const br_ec_impl *iec) in br_ssl_engine_set_ec() argument
1665 cc->iec = iec; in br_ssl_engine_set_ec()
1688 return cc->iec; in br_ssl_engine_get_ec()
2588 const br_ec_impl *iec; member
2927 const br_ec_impl *iec, br_ecdsa_sign iecdsa);
3283 const br_ec_impl *iec; member
3836 const br_ec_impl *iec, br_ecdsa_sign iecdsa);
/freebsd/contrib/bearssl/tools/
H A Dclient.c346 const br_ec_impl *iec; in cc_do_keyx() local
352 iec = br_ec_get_default(); in cc_do_keyx()
353 r = iec->mul(data, *len, zc->sk->key.ec.x, in cc_do_keyx()
355 xoff = iec->xoff(zc->sk->key.ec.curve, &xlen); in cc_do_keyx()
H A Dserver.c485 const br_ec_impl *iec; in sp_do_keyx() local
492 iec = br_ec_get_default(); in sp_do_keyx()
493 r = iec->mul(data, *len, pc->sk->key.ec.x, in sp_do_keyx()
495 xoff = iec->xoff(pc->sk->key.ec.curve, &xlen); in sp_do_keyx()
H A Dsslio.c310 if (cc->iec != 0) { in run_ssl_engine()
312 get_algo_name(cc->iec, 0)); in run_ssl_engine()
/freebsd/sys/dev/mvs/
H A Dmvs.c704 uint32_t iec, serr = 0, fisic = 0; in mvs_ch_intr() local
714 iec = ATA_INL(ch->r_mem, EDMA_IEC); in mvs_ch_intr()
715 if (iec & EDMA_IE_SERRINT) { in mvs_ch_intr()
720 if (iec & EDMA_IE_ESELFDIS) in mvs_ch_intr()
723 if (iec & EDMA_IE_ETRANSINT) { in mvs_ch_intr()
735 ATA_OUTL(ch->r_mem, EDMA_IEC, ~iec); in mvs_ch_intr()
737 if (iec & (0xfc1e9000 | EDMA_IE_EDEVERR)) { in mvs_ch_intr()
778 if (iec & EDMA_IE_EDEVERR) { /* Device error. */ in mvs_ch_intr()
794 } else if (iec & 0xfc1e9000) { in mvs_ch_intr()
811 if ((iec & (EDMA_IE_EDEVDIS | EDMA_IE_EDEVCON)) || in mvs_ch_intr()
/freebsd/contrib/elftoolchain/elfcopy/
H A Delfcopy.h181 int iec; /* elfclass of input object */ member
H A Dmain.c294 if ((ecp->iec = gelf_getclass(ecp->ein)) == ELFCLASSNONE) in create_elf()
299 ecp->oec = ecp->iec; in create_elf()
1652 ecp->iec = ecp->oec = ELFCLASSNONE; in main()
/freebsd/contrib/bearssl/test/
H A Dtest_crypto.c8635 test_EC_c25519(const char *name, const br_ec_impl *iec) in test_EC_c25519() argument
8648 if (!iec->mul(bu, sizeof bu, bk, sizeof bk, BR_EC_curve25519)) { in test_EC_c25519()
8667 if (!iec->mul(bu, sizeof bu, bk, sizeof bk, BR_EC_curve25519)) { in test_EC_c25519()
9139 test_ECDSA_KAT(const br_ec_impl *iec, in test_ECDSA_KAT() argument
9167 if (vrfy(iec, hash, hash_len, in test_ECDSA_KAT()
9174 if (vrfy(iec, hash, hash_len, in test_ECDSA_KAT()
9181 if (vrfy(iec, hash, hash_len, in test_ECDSA_KAT()
9188 sig2_len = sign(iec, kv->hf, hash, kv->priv, sig2); in test_ECDSA_KAT()
/freebsd/contrib/bearssl/src/x509/
H A Dx509_minimal.c1709 if (!ctx->iecdsa(ctx->iec, ctx->tbs_hash, in verify_signature()
H A Dx509_minimal.t0407 if (!ctx->iecdsa(ctx->iec, ctx->tbs_hash,